How Elemental Magic Works
In Frieren's world, elemental magic operates through visualization and mana control. Mages must clearly visualize their desired outcome while channeling their mana through specific spell formulas. The strength of elemental magic depends on the caster's mana capacity, visualization skills, and understanding of the spell's underlying principles.

Beyond Basic Elements
While elemental magic forms the foundation, Frieren's magic system extends far beyond basic fire, water, earth, and air spells. The series features curse magic, detection spells, barrier magic, and even seemingly mundane utility spells that often prove surprisingly powerful in creative applications.
